Ear Comfort Matters: Dr. Goldberg's Tips for Avoiding Hearing Aid Domes Itch
Do you find yourself constantly adjusting your hearing aid domes because of discomfort? Some of people experience this frustrating issue with their hearing aids. Thankfully, Dr. Goldberg has some expert recommendations to help you avoid that pesky irritation. First and foremost, make sure your domes are the correct dimension for your ears. Ill-fitting domes can trap sweat, leading to redness. Additionally, disinfect your domes regularly with a delicate cloth and warm water. This helps eliminate buildup of earwax and bacteria that can cause itching.
- Think about using silicone domes, which tend to be more tolerable for sensitive ears.
- Stay away from touching your ears excessively as this can introduce microorganisms
- Talk to your audiologist if you experience persistent irritation. They may recommend different dome materials or hearing aid settings to improve your comfort.
By following these simple suggestions, you can say goodbye to those bothersome itchy domes and enjoy the benefits of your hearing aids with renewed comfort.
